Backend Developer at Radius Interior Design
Abu Dhabi, , United Arab Emirates -
Full Time


Start Date

Immediate

Expiry Date

01 Oct, 25

Salary

0.0

Posted On

02 Jul, 25

Experience

5 year(s) or above

Remote Job

Yes

Telecommute

Yes

Sponsor Visa

No

Skills

Rabbitmq, Code, Mysql, Docker, Azure, Kubernetes, Mongodb, Https, Celery, Python, Containerization, Relational Databases

Industry

Information Technology/IT

Description

ABOUT DIVERGE AI

Diverge AI is a pioneering artificial intelligence company based in Abu Dhabi, UAE. We deliver transformative AI solutions that empower industries and drive innovation. As we expand, we are seeking experienced professionals who are passionate about building robust, secure, and scalable software systems.

REQUIRED SKILLS & EXPERTISE

  • 5+ years of professional backend development experience, with a focus on Python.
  • Proven previous experience in designing and maintaining production-grade backend systems.
  • Expertise with FastAPI or Flask frameworks.
  • Strong understanding of API security best practices (OAuth2, JWT, HTTPS, etc.).
  • Solid experience with Docker for containerization.
  • Experience deploying systems on internal servers as well as cloud platforms (AWS, GCP, or Azure).
  • Proficiency with relational databases (Postgres, MySQL) and familiarity with NoSQL solutions (MongoDB, Redis).
  • Strong debugging and testing skills with frameworks like Pytest.
  • Good understanding of RESTful standards and best practices.
  • Familiarity with message brokers and task queues (RabbitMQ, Celery, etc.) is a plus.
  • Experience integrating with external APIs and third-party services.
  • Experience with version control systems (Git) and collaborative development workflows.
  • Familiarity with DevOps principles and tools (CI/CD pipelines, infrastructure-as-code, monitoring tools) is preferred.
  • Strong problem-solving skills and ability to work in a fast-paced, collaborative team environment.

PREFERRED QUALIFICATIONS

  • Experience with Kubernetes or other orchestration systems.
  • Experience with serverless technologies is a plus.
  • Knowledge of logging and monitoring solutions (Prometheus, Grafana, ELK stack, etc.).

How To Apply:

Incase you would like to apply to this job directly from the source, please click here

Responsibilities

ABOUT THE ROLE

We are looking for a Backend Developer with 5+ years of hands-on coding experience, a strong command of Python, and a proven track record of developing secure, reliable, and scalable backend systems. You will be responsible for designing, developing, and deploying APIs and backend services to power our AI-driven platforms.

KEY RESPONSIBILITIES

  • Design and develop secure, efficient, and scalable RESTful APIs using FastAPI or Flask.
  • Architect and build backend systems that integrate seamlessly with AI pipelines and data platforms.
  • Ensure best practices for security, authentication, and authorization are followed in API development.
  • Optimize backend performance, including caching strategies, database optimization, and request handling.
  • Containerize applications using Docker and orchestrate deployments to internal servers or cloud environments.
  • Manage deployment pipelines and ensure smooth CI/CD processes.
  • Collaborate with frontend developers, data engineers, and AI engineers to deliver complete, production-ready systems.
  • Monitor, troubleshoot, and resolve production issues effectively.
  • Maintain clear, thorough, and well-documented codebases.
  • Stay updated with industry best practices and emerging technologies to ensure our systems remain modern and secure.
Loading...